Thank you for selecting the Tracer BP MPPT solar charge

The controller will limit the battery charging current to the Maximum Battery Current rating. Therefore an oversized solar array will not operate at peak power. What is a Solar Net Meter? A solar net meter is a bidirectional electric meter that records two types of data:. 1. Electricity consumed from the grid when your solar panels are not producing enough power (e.g., during the night or cloudy days).. 2. Excess electricity sent back to the grid when your solar panels generate more power than you need (e.g., during peak

Where to connect Battery Monitor/Shunt

The red wire supplies the power to the meter but also is the reference for the Voltage reading on the front of the meter. So yes, you can connect it to a + terminal on your fuse box ( not series ) and it will read the voltage at that point in the circuit. shorting solar panels for testing current

As the battery gets >~80% state of charge, the battery charging voltage will rise (to ~14.2 volts for GEL) and then the charge will switch from "bulk" (maximum available charging current) to Absorb charging mode (charger holds ~14.2 volts constant, battery slowly takes less current until 100% full--Can take between 2-6+ hours for a "full absorb" cycle for Lead Acid batteries).

How do I connect a battery to my solar charge controller?

Connecting the Battery to the Solar Charge Controller Look for the battery terminals on your solar charge controller. They are often marked as ‘Battery’ or ‘Batt’. Pay attention to the polarity (+/-) marked on your device. Ensure your controller is not connected to any power source.

What is a solar charge controller?

Charge controllers regulate the voltage and current coming from the solar panels to prevent battery overcharging. Batteries store excess energy for later use. Lithium-ion and lead-acid are common battery types in solar installations.

Why do solar panels need a charge controller?

Charge controllers protect your battery system from overcharging, depth of discharge, and voltage fluctuations. By doing so, they extend battery life and improve overall system efficiency.
